Hyderabad: Leader of the Opposition in AP Assembly and YSR Congress Party president YS Jagan Mohan Reddy on Wednesday came down heavily on AP Chief Minister N Chandrababu Naidu for failing to implement the poll promises he had made to the people.
He alleged that Chandrababu failed to keep his promises to the youth even three years after coming to power. YS Jagan demanded that the dues should be paid for the unemployed youth who were waiting for the past 33 months.
Besides giving monthly income to the unemployed youth, the YSRCP chief demanded that the income should also be given to 1 crore and 75 lakh families in the State irrespective of caste, creed and religion.
